Sheriff Evangelidis Speaks to Blackstone Valley Tech Students About Drug Abuse

Worcester County Sheriff Lew Evangelidis spoke to Blackstone Valley Tech students about making smart decisions if they are faced with drug and alcohol related incidents through the Face2Face Drug Awareness program. 

The Sheriff showed students the effects that abusing prescription drugs can take. 

 “One reason drugs are out there is because somebody is making a buck. They don’t care about you or your family. They want you to get addicted to a drug so they can make more money,” said Evangelidis. 

He went on to ask students to learn from the mistakes of others and take advantage of the positive opportunities that are around them. 

Assistant Principal Matthew Urquhart worked with the District’s Substance Abuse Committee and the Sheriff’s office to bring the program to Valley Tech. 

“It’s important for our students to understand the impact of drug and alcohol abuse. We’re constantly trying to teach our students to be respectful, productive citizens, and teach them how to respond to different situations they may face after graduation. We always try to empower our students to make strong, sound decisions when facing any and all challenges – specifically challenges that have dire consequences,” said Urquhart.

Face2Face 

The Face2Face Drug Awareness Program uses cameras and software to show the ways drug use can change a person’s appearances within a few years. The software shows the effects drug use can have on skin, teeth, and hair over time. 

The students are shown “before and after” photos of people to demonstrate that drug use impacts their appearance as well as their health. The photo evidence has a lasting impact on appearance-conscious adolescents.

Drug and Alcohol Abuse in Massachusetts 

In the first nine months of 2016, there have been 1,005 cases of unintentional opioid overdose death in Massachusetts, according to the Massachusetts Department of Public Health.
